Sweet and Spicy Pork Stir-Fry with Noodles

Ingredients
- 12 ounces dry Chinese noodles
- 3 tablespoons soy sauce
- 3/4 cup sweet chili sauce
- 1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1/4 teaspoon ground ginger
- 3 tablespoons sesame oil
- 1/2 cup soy sauce
- 1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1 (1 pound) pork loin, cut into 2-inch strips
- 2 tablespoons cooking oil
- 2 onions, cut into bite-size pieces
- 1/8 teaspoon crushed red pepper flakes
- 3 tablespoons sweet chili sauce
- 3 cups chopped napa cabbage
- 3/4 cup sliced celery
- 1 cup sliced carrots
- 3 red bell peppers, chopped
- 2 teaspoons cornstarch
- 1/4 cup cold water
Instructions
1
Start by filling a large pot with salted water and placing it on the stovetop over high heat. Bring the water to a vigorous boil, then gently add the noodles and return it to a rolling boil. Continue cooking the pasta uncovered, occasionally stirring it with a spoon, until it reaches your desired level of doneness - still retaining some firmness in the center. Remove from heat and carefully pour it into a colander placed in the sink to drain.
2
In a large bowl, combine 3 tablespoons of soy sauce, 3/4 cup of sweet chili sauce, 1/2 teaspoon of garlic powder, ground ginger, and a generous amount of sesame oil. Add the cooked noodles to this mixture and toss everything together until the noodles are evenly coated with the sauce. Set the bowl aside for now.
3
In another large bowl, whisk together 1/2 cup of soy sauce and 1/2 teaspoon of garlic powder. Add the pork to this bowl and stir until it's evenly coated with the marinade. Allow the pork to sit for 5 minutes, allowing the flavors to penetrate.
4
Heat a substantial amount of cooking oil in a wok or a large, deep skillet over medium-high heat. Add the pork, onions, and red pepper flakes to the pan and cook until the pork is completely browned. Stir in 3 tablespoons of sweet chili sauce, napa cabbage, celery, carrots, and bell peppers. Continue cooking and stirring the mixture until all the vegetables are heated through, approximately 5 minutes.
5
In a separate bowl, whisk together cornstarch and water until smooth. Add this mixture to the stir-fry and continue stirring until it thickens. Finally, serve the entire dish over your cooked noodles.
